WebUsing CBIT, our clinician works with patients to: train him or her to be more aware of tics. develop and implement “competing” behaviors when he or she identifies the urge to tic, … WebAug 8, 2024 · The criteria used to diagnose Tourette syndrome include: Both motor tics and vocal tics are present, although not necessarily at the same time. Tics occur several times a day, nearly every day or intermittently, for more than a year. Tics begin before age 18. Tics aren't caused by medications, other substances or another medical condition.

WebMar 8, 2024 · There are two types of tics. Motor tics involve body movements. Examples include shrugging, moving your arms or hands, or blinking. Vocal tics involve making sounds. Vocal tics can include words, but often include other sounds like growls, coughs, or throat-clearing. Tics can also be simple or complex. Simple tics involve one body part or …
